Pros

They don't expect much of you, unlimited discretionary time off, opportunities for advancement/promotion.

Cons

Toxic culture, lack of visibility from management, boys club, 1/3 of the staff does nothing and get's paid double what the rest of us made, contributions are not recognized unless they are in service to the largest accounts, favoritism of staff for commission (people would be assigned to book loads for a number of small accounts and wouldn't have access to booking loads for bigger accounts so right off the bat they were screwed out of commission, say theres 2 carrier reps, 1 books 300 loads for a bunch of small accounts with no profit margins, doesn't make any comission. The person sitting next to them was assigned to book for a large account, books 200 loads and makes $20K comission that month. Makes no sense.) Unspoken understanding that if you arent working at least 50 hours a week you are lazy.
